πΌπΈ PART 1 | Samoan Language Week πΌπΈ
What a meaningful week of learning, discovery, and celebration!
Our tamariki explored Samoan culture through a variety of experiences, including learning about the Samoan flag, practising Samoan greetings, creating beautiful leis, and discovering some of Samoa's unique flora and fauna.
Through stories, songs, art, and conversations, our children developed a deeper appreciation for the language, culture, and traditions of Samoa. These experiences help nurture a strong sense of belonging while encouraging respect and understanding for the diverse cultures within our community. β€οΈ

A big thank you to our wonderful Nurse Pania for visiting our Playful Pathways tamariki! ππ©ββοΈ
Our 4 year olds took part in their hearing and vision checks as part of their journey towards school readiness. We are so proud of how brave, cooperative, and confident everyone was during the process! ππβ¨
These important checks help support our tamariki as they prepare for their exciting next step into school life. Thank you Nurse Pania for your kindness, care, and support for our little learners and whΔnau πΏπ
